In today's episode Nicky P & Lizzie examine Redemption Song by Bob Marley. Reggae just gets me. But do we get raggae? You decide. https://youtu.be/xUNh9lmmUA8 This week in I Heard This Happened: some power-pop-rock and some russian post-rock. Nicky’s album this week is Night Terrors by Wires, somewhere between Cheap Trick & They Might Be Giants filtered through Fountains Of Wayne & Rooney. It’s got a great late-90’s early 00’s production & sensibility that reminds me of the mood & tone of everything hip when I went to college. For what is predominantly a solo album, there is a surprising depth of songwriting, my favorite being Let It Go which has some moments where it reminds me of Queen & ELO…so you can do the math on how I feel about it. http://wiresmusic.bandcamp.com/album/night-terrors-2 Lizzie brings us Firefly by iwantsummer, an instrumental post-rock album out of St. Petersburg, Russia.
